This course delivers an in-depth exploration of fire safety, health and safety legislation, COSHH (Control of Substances Hazardous to Health), construction safety standards, and essential first aid practices. It begins by addressing the legal frameworks and practical applications of health and safety in the workplace, with a specific focus on risk assessment, hazard identification, and workplace policies.
Fire safety modules cover fire prevention, evacuation protocols, use of extinguishers, and the key duties of a fire marshal. Health and safety content includes accident prevention, emergency procedures, and maintaining a safe working environment. COSHH sections provide insights into hazardous substances, proper labeling, storage, and protective measures. Construction safety training explores working at height, personal protective equipment (PPE), site hazard control, and machinery safety.
First aid and first aid at work modules are tailored to teach essential life-saving interventions such as CPR, wound treatment, shock management, and injury response. This ensures that individuals can act quickly and effectively in emergencies, reducing harm and improving outcomes.
